The mass media has been abuzz the last few days with the news that the University of Helsinki is planning to confer a Honorary Doctorate to Greta Thunberg.    “….the university says that 30 ‘distinguished individuals from around the world’ will become ‘new honorary doctors’ and be awarded the title of ‘doctor honoris causa’ which is called ‘the University’s highest recognition.’”  [ source ]  (“honoris causa” is Latin meaning “for the sake of honor”).

This award will place Ms. Greta Tintin Eleonora Ernman Thunberg on the same intellectual pedestal as Kermit the Frog.  “In 1996, Southampton College at Long Island University (now a campus of Stony Brook University) awarded an Honorary Doctorate of Amphibious Letters to the Muppet, Kermit the Frog.”   Appropriately, one of Greta’s given names is Tintin, who I think would have been proud to be linked to the more currently famous Kermit, however tenuously.

The University of Helsinki has the following faculties: Faculty of Agriculture and Forestry; Faculty of Arts; Faculty of Biological and Environmental Sciences; Faculty of Educational Sciences; Faculty of Law; Faculty of Medicine; Faculty of Pharmacy; Faculty of Science; Faculty of Social Sciences; Faculty of Veterinary Medicine; Swedish School of Social Science and the Faculty of Theology.

Their rationale for conferring an Honorary Doctorate is given as:

Greta Thunberg is a Swedish opinion-maker and activist. The School Strike for Climate she staged outside the Swedish parliament building in autumn 2018 soon expanded into the global Fridays for Future movement, in which schoolchildren urge decision-makers to take climate action based on scientific evidence. [sic]  The value of her uncompromising and consistent work for the future of our planet has been recognised with several major awards and prizes. Her actions have obliged all of us with the task, as members of communities and societies, but above all as human beings, of making changes to our everyday lives.” [ source ]

So, they are giving her a doctorate from which discipline?  Biological and Environmental Sciences?  Sciences?  Social Sciences?   No, none of those.

“The Faculty of Theology of the University of Helsinki will award an honorary doctorate to Greta Thunberg”.
